Founder Peyush Bansal tests Lenskart’s B Smartglasses
The new Lenskart B Smartglasses are gaining a lot of attention after a reel shared by Lenskart CEO Peyush Bansal.
In the clip, he uses the glasses to check the calories in his dinner, turning a small routine moment into a fun and informative demo. The reel gives viewers a real sense of how the Lenskart B Smartglasses fit into normal everyday use.
Peyush Bansal’s Shows How Fast the Lenskart B Smartglasses Respond
In the video, Peyush Bansal asks the Lenskart B Smartglasses to break down the calories and protein in his sandwich. The AI assistant responds with an estimate of 369 calories and 20.3 grams of protein, and even points out that the meal may be on the heavier side for dinner.
He ends the chat with a simple thank you, keeping the moment casual and relatable.
The caption adds humour, saying he thought his dinner was sorted until the glasses checked his sandwich “like it’s a crime scene.” He jokes that dinner got cancelled. He also mentions that the future feels exciting as this new device brings fresh ways to use AI in day-to-day life.
This short exchange gives viewers a clear idea of how quick and natural the AI inside the Lenskart B Smartglasses feels. Instead of giving a staged demo, the reel shows a real moment that many people can connect with.
Lenskart B Smartglasses Features
The Lenskart B Smartglasses come with several features made for daily use, comfort, and quick access to information.
Below is a clear look at the main features that buyers in India will want to know about.
- Qualcomm Snapdragon AR1 Gen 1 Chipset - This chipset is built for light AR tasks and smooth on-device AI. It helps the glasses respond quickly without needing a constant internet link, which makes daily use easier.
- Built-in Sony Camera - The Sony camera lets users take photos and record videos without holding a phone. It is useful for travel, work, and moments when the user wants to stay hands-free.
- Google Gemini 2.5 Live AI Assistant - The glasses include a voice assistant that can answer questions, explain details, and help with daily tasks. The response feels natural and fast, similar to talking to a helpful companion.
- UPI Payments Through QR Code Scan - Users can scan QR codes using the camera and pay through UPI without taking out their phone. This can help in shops, cafés, and quick day-to-day payments.
- Real-Time Language Translation - The glasses can translate speech across different languages. This helps during travel, work meetings or speaking with someone who uses another language.
- 40-Gram Lightweight Frame - At around 40 grams, the Lenskart B Smartglasses are lighter than many other options. This makes them easier to wear for long hours without strain.
- Offline AI for Better Privacy - Many actions happen directly on the device without sending data to servers. This helps with faster replies and keeps more personal information on the glasses.
